Transaction dd1da0980b1aabd422faedfefde5fd39e67062231af65a6b9fc4ed7e64a0f13a
1 Input
1 Output
-
dd1da0980b1aabd422faedfefde5fd39e67062231af65a6b9fc4ed7e64a0f13a:0
- value
- 89422802
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e6e3fcb57f84a3dc69a1e7f9ebe16abd707691f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Dz72VKwGDQGmFh4zhZcubj6FocZrqJdUt